Bylaws
A set of governing rules adopted by a corporation or other association.
Organizational Meeting
An initial gathering designed to establish the structure or operation of an organization, committee, or project.
Corporation Adopts
The process through which a corporation formally adopts policies, procedures, or changes in structure.
Declaring Dividends
The action by a company's board of directors to distribute a portion of earnings to shareholders as a reward for their investment.
